Steps To Follow After An Intersection Incident?

In the aftermath of an crossroad accident, individuals should prioritize their safety and the welfare of others. The first step is to inspect any injury and call for medical assistance if necessary. Next, heading to a safe location, if possible, can help avert further accidents. It is vital to share contact details with other drivers involved, including names, contact information, and insurance information. Documenting the scene is also important; taking photographs of vehicle damage, license plates, and the intersection can give valuable supporting evidence later.

In addition, collecting witness statements may turn out beneficial. Filing the incident to regional law enforcement is essential, as an official report can facilitate future claims. Finally, individuals should refrain from taking responsibility at the scene, as this can impede potential contractual results. By following these steps, individuals can verify they are equipped to traverse the aftermath of the accident productively.

Standard Challenges In Claiming Compensation For Intersection Crashes

Considerable obstacles can arise when requesting monetary damages for intersection accidents, making complicated the rehabilitation process for victims. One substantial challenge is establishing liability, as several parties may be involved, resulting in conflicts over who is at fault. Insurance companies often deploy strategies to reduce payouts, challenging the degree of injuries or the validity of claims. Victims may also face difficulties in collecting sufficient evidence, such as traffic camera footage or witness statements, which are crucial for substantiating their case.

Additionally, strict deadlines for submitting claims can obstruct the recovery process, leaving victims vulnerable to losing their entitlement to damages. The intricacy of regional driving regulations and regulations can additionally compound matters, obligating victims to traverse statutory subtleties that may not be readily obvious. These barriers emphasize the importance of having experienced legal representation to effectively address and overcome these challenges in quest for deserved damages.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Categories of Damages Can I Claim After an Intersection Accident?

Should an intersection accident take place, claimants may claim compensation for clinical costs, lost wages, property damage, suffering and torment, emotional distress, and any long-term disability or rehabilitation costs caused by the incident.

What Timeframe Applies to Submitting a Claim for My Event?

In most territories, claimants typically have two to three years from the date of the accident to register a claim. However, specific timelines can diverge, so it's critical to reference local laws for accurate information.

Does My Insurance Include Court Costs for an Crash Attorney?

Insurance policies differ significantly, but numerous do not cover attorney costs for a personal injury lawyer. It is crucial to examine the particular details of the coverage or consult the insurer for explanation.

Am I allowed to speak for myself in an junction collision legal matter?

Yes, an person can represent themselves in an traffic collision matter. However, without legal expertise, they may face challenges navigating intricate legal requirements and processes, potentially impacting their likelihood of receiving fair compensation for losses sustained.

What happens if the different Driver Lacks coverage or Has inadequate Insurance?

When the other driver is inadequately insured, the individual may have to depend on their own policy protection, such as uninsured motorist coverage, or initiate legal proceedings against the responsible party for damages.
